Dreo Space Heater Review: My Experience with the DR-HSH004
I’ll start by saying that the Dreo Space Heater DR-HSH004 has been a surprisingly delightful addition to my home. As someone who battles drafty winters in an older house, I’ve tried my fair share of space heaters. This one stands out for a mix of performance, convenience, and safety features, but it’s not without its quirks.
Picture this: It’s a frosty morning, the kind where stepping out of bed feels like stepping into a freezer. I placed the Dreo Space Heater next to my desk, turned it on, and within a minute, I could feel a wave of warmth radiating across the room. The PTC ceramic heating element is no joke—it heats up fast, perfect for those impatient moments when you just need warmth right now. The 1500W power combined with the 70° oscillation ensures the heat isn’t just concentrated in one spot but spreads evenly.
The remote control is a lifesaver. Do I want to adjust the temperature from the couch? Yes. Am I willing to walk across the room to do it? Absolutely not. The remote has a sleek design and is easy to use, making it perfect for lazy winter days. My teenager, who seems to think her room should feel like a tropical paradise, has claimed the heater for herself more than once. She loves the programmable digital thermostat, which adjusts in 1°F increments, and I love that the ECO mode keeps our energy bills from skyrocketing.
Features That Caught My Attention
This heater offers five modes: High, Medium, Low, ECO, and Fan Only. While I mostly use the High or ECO modes, the Fan Only mode has been a surprising bonus for mild days when you just want a bit of air circulation. The LED display and control panel are intuitive and modern, and the 12-hour timer lets me set it and forget it, especially when using it at night.
The Shield360° safety features are a game-changer. From tip-over protection to overheat safeguards, I felt secure using it even when my curious pets wandered a bit too close. The UL94 V-0 flame-retardant materials provide peace of mind, knowing it’s built with safety in mind.
Where It Shines (and Where It Doesn’t)
Compared to other heaters I’ve owned, the Dreo DR-HSH004 is remarkably quiet. At just 37.5 dB, it’s no louder than a gentle hum. I’ve used it during Zoom meetings without anyone noticing, and it doesn’t disturb my sleep.
However, for larger spaces, this heater might struggle. My living room is about 200 sq. ft., which is right at the heater’s maximum coverage. While it does warm up the space, it takes a bit longer than I’d like, especially on frigid days. If you’re looking to heat a large open-concept area, this might not be the best choice.
Battle of the Heaters: Competitors vs. Dreo
I’ve also tried the Lasko Ceramic Tower Heater, which excels in heating larger spaces but lacks the compact portability of the Dreo. The Dyson Hot+Cool is a premium option with smart features but comes with a hefty price tag. The Dreo strikes a balance—it’s compact, affordable, and packed with features that make it ideal for small to medium-sized rooms.

How to Use Guide
- Position the Heater: Place it on a flat, stable surface, ensuring nothing obstructs the air intake or outlet.
- Plug It In: Use a standard 120V outlet—avoid extension cords for safety.
- Power On: Press the power button on the unit or remote.
- Select Mode: Use the LED panel or remote to choose from High, Medium, Low, ECO, or Fan Only modes.
- Set Temperature: Adjust the digital thermostat in 1°F increments to your desired setting.
- Activate Oscillation: Press the oscillation button for 70° heat distribution.
- Timer Settings: Set the 1-12 hour timer for automatic shut-off.
- Safety Check: Ensure the heater is upright and not near flammable materials.
